In electromagnetic dip-angle (tilt-angle) profiling surveys, the frequency used controls the effective skin depth (depth of investigation): higher frequencies have shallower skin depths (more rapid signal attenuation with depth) while lower frequencies penetrate to greater depths; a zero crossover in the dip-angle response marks the horizontal position of a subsurface conductor, and if the same crossover location is observed consistently across multiple parallel profiles, this indicates the conductor has a strike length and orientation consistent with intersecting all of those profiles at that position.
